Output e90109df18ec51724bfd3f49e5ac52fcd482bdd23b77a9fd873e68313cd4f4df:6

value
842973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 637ae785e287ee39362b078bb686e3cfbd4cce9e OP_EQUAL
address
3Am245gHQ5ewUjBHh1zK7xn3vH184vW5zt
transaction
e90109df18ec51724bfd3f49e5ac52fcd482bdd23b77a9fd873e68313cd4f4df
spent
true